Abstract
We devise and develop a new workbench integrating, among other elements, two touch screens and a holographic display with touch film for a novel form of collaborative design of virtual scenes. Two users sitting at opposite ends of a table are enabled to collaboratively build 3D virtual scenes. They design a 2D planar graph via the regular touch screens, while the corresponding 3D scene is displayed on the holographic display screen simultaneously. One user's interactions with the touch screen or touch film can be observed by the other instantaneously. A smart phone or tablet can also connect into this system remotely so that more users can join the cooperative work. This workbench has many advantages in co-location work, such as the convenience of user communication and the flexibility of the provided views. It improves the efficiency of the design and the quality of the virtual scene construction.
